Notice Title
The provision of Appropriate Adult and Triage Service
Notice Description
The Appropriate Adult and Triage service for Derbyshire Constabulary. This service is for deployment of trained people to attend site within 60 minutes of receiving a call on a 24 hour, 7 days a week, 365 days a year service on a call out basis for all ages of Children and Vulnerable Adults detained for interview. This contract commences 1st September 2021 until 31st August 2021 for 3 years initial term, with an option to extend for a further 2 x 12 months, a total of 5 years to 31st August 2026.

Open Contracting Data Standard (OCDS)
The Open Contracting Data Standard (OCDS) is a framework designed to increase transparency and access to public procurement data in the public sector. It is widely used by governments and organisations worldwide to report on procurement processes and contracts.
